Ban electric, choke and prong collars for dogs in England.

The Issue

In 2018, the government announced that it would ban the use of electric shock collars, or e-collars for dog training. However, as it stands today, no such ban has been put in place and so-called dog "trainers" continue to advertise and use them. 

The Kennel Club has opposed the use of such devices, stating that research has highlighted "that usage of the device poses a risk to dog welfare and causes unnecessary suffering, as well as indicating that there is little evidence of improved behavioural outcomes". 

In January of this year, the French Assembly voted to ban e-collars, as well as choke and prong collars as they cause psychological and physical harm to animals.
